Animal Behavior and Veterinary Science: Bridging the Gap Between Mind and Medicine

For decades, veterinary medicine focused almost exclusively on the physical health of animals—vaccinations, surgeries, and the eradication of parasites. However, as our understanding of the animal kingdom has evolved, so too has the realization that mental and physical health are inextricably linked. Today, the intersection of animal behavior and veterinary science represents one of the most dynamic and essential fields in modern animal care. The Evolution of Clinical Ethology

Clinical ethology—the study of animal behavior in a veterinary context—has shifted from a niche interest to a core component of general practice. This change is driven by the understanding that a "healthy" animal is not merely one free of disease, but one that is mentally stimulated and emotionally stable.

In veterinary science, behavior is often the first clinical sign of a physical ailment. A cat that stops grooming might be suffering from arthritis; a dog that becomes suddenly aggressive might be experiencing neurological pain. By integrating behavioral science, veterinarians can diagnose underlying medical issues much faster than through physical exams alone. Why Behavior Matters in the Clinic

The integration of behavior into veterinary science serves three primary purposes: 1. Reducing Stress and Fear-Free Care

The "Fear-Free" movement has revolutionized how clinics operate. Veterinary scientists now use behavioral knowledge to modify the clinic environment—using pheromone diffusers, specialized handling techniques, and treat-motivated exams. Reducing cortisol levels during a visit doesn’t just make the pet happier; it ensures more accurate blood pressure readings, heart rates, and diagnostic results. 2. Strengthening the Human-Animal Bond

Behavioral issues are the leading cause of "relinquishment"—the surrender of pets to shelters. When a veterinarian can address separation anxiety, compulsive behaviors, or inter-pet aggression through a combination of behavioral modification and pharmacology, they aren’t just treating a symptom; they are saving a life by preserving the bond between the owner and the animal. 3. Pharmacology and the "Brain-Body" Connection

Veterinary science has made massive strides in psychopharmacology. Medications like SSRIs (Selective Serotonin Reuptake Inhibitors) are now used alongside behavioral training to treat severe anxiety and OCD in animals. Understanding the neurobiology of the animal brain allows veterinarians to prescribe treatments that rebalance brain chemistry, making training and rehabilitation possible. Beyond the Clinic: Agriculture and Conservation

The synergy between behavior and veterinary science extends far beyond domestic pets.

Livestock Welfare: In agricultural science, understanding the herd behavior and stress responses of cattle, pigs, and poultry is vital. Lower stress levels during handling lead to better immune systems, higher growth rates, and overall better food quality.

Wildlife Conservation: For endangered species in captivity, veterinary science uses behavioral enrichment to mimic natural environments. This is crucial for successful breeding programs and the eventual reintroduction of species into the wild. The Future: AI and Behavioral Diagnostics

We are entering an era where technology is enhancing the vet’s ability to "read" behavior. Wearable technology—similar to fitness trackers for humans—can now monitor an animal’s sleep patterns, scratching frequency, and activity levels. In the near future, AI algorithms will likely assist veterinary scientists in predicting illness based on subtle behavioral deviations long before physical symptoms appear. Conclusion

The Importance of Animal Behavior in Veterinary Science

Animal behavior is a critical aspect of veterinary science, as it provides valuable insights into an animal's physical and mental well-being. Behavioral observations can help veterinarians identify potential health issues, such as pain, anxiety, or stress, which may not be immediately apparent through physical examination alone. By understanding normal and abnormal animal behavior, veterinarians can:

  1. Detect early warning signs of disease: Changes in behavior can be an early indicator of disease or discomfort in animals. For example, a decrease in appetite or water intake can be a sign of dental problems or kidney disease.
  2. Improve animal welfare: Understanding animal behavior helps veterinarians and animal caregivers provide a safe and stress-free environment, promoting overall animal welfare.
  3. Enhance diagnosis and treatment: Behavioral information can aid in the diagnosis of conditions such as anxiety disorders, phobias, or cognitive dysfunction.

Paper Title: The Role of Ethological Indicators in the Early Diagnosis of Chronic Pain in Domestic Canines 1. Introduction

Background: Traditional veterinary diagnostics often rely on physiological markers (blood tests, imaging), but these may not capture the early stages of chronic conditions like osteoarthritis.

The Problem: Animals instinctively mask physical weakness. By the time physiological symptoms are obvious, the disease is often advanced.

Objective: This paper explores how "sickness behaviors" and subtle changes in daily habits can serve as primary diagnostic indicators for veterinary clinicians. 2. Literature Review

Behavior as a Clinical Sign: Changes in appetite, social interaction, and grooming are often the first outward signs of internal distress.

The Human-Animal Bond: Veterinarians must rely on owner observations, but these are often subjective. There is a need for standardized behavioral assessment tools in clinical settings.

Technological Integration: Recent studies from platforms like Nature - Scientific Reports highlight how deep learning and video-based models are beginning to outperform or supplement human observation in assessing pain. 3. Methodology

The Future: The Behavioral Veterinarian

As the field grows, the veterinary behaviorist (a vet with additional residency training in behavior) is becoming a crucial specialist. They handle the complex cases: inter-dog aggression in the same household, severe obsessive-compulsive disorders (tail chasing, fly snapping), and exotic animal behavior.

Furthermore, telemedicine has exploded in this niche. Owners can now video-record a seizure or an aggressive outburst and share it with a behaviorist remotely, leading to faster, more accurate diagnoses.

The Toolbox: From Prozac to Positive Reinforcement

The integration of behavior into vet med has transformed the treatment toolbox. Gone are the days when a "bad dog" was simply sedated or surrendered. Today, a multimodal approach is standard:

  1. Medical Workup: Rule out organic disease first (thyroid issues in aggressive cats, brain tumors in sudden-onset aggression).
  2. Pharmacology: SSRIs (like fluoxetine), TCAs, and situational anxiolytics are now prescribed to correct neurochemical imbalances, allowing the animal to be calm enough to learn.
  3. Behavioral Modification: This is where the owner comes in. Desensitization and counter-conditioning (DS/CC) retrain the brain’s emotional response to triggers.
  4. Environmental Management: Adjusting the home setup (hiding spots, vertical space for cats, puzzle feeders) to reduce conflict.
